2009 Tata Indica vs. 2005 Saab 05-Sep

To start off, 2009 Tata Indica is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Saab 05-Sep.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Saab 05-Sep would be higher. At 1,985 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Saab 05-Sep is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Saab 05-Sep (148 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 74 more horse power than 2009 Tata Indica. (74 HP @ 4500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Saab 05-Sep should accelerate faster than 2009 Tata Indica.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Saab 05-Sep weights approximately 657 kg more than 2009 Tata Indica.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Saab 05-Sep (240 Nm @ 1800 RPM) has 125 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Tata Indica. (115 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2005 Saab 05-Sep will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Tata Indica. 2005 Saab 05-Sep has automatic transmission and 2009 Tata Indica has manual transmission. 2009 Tata Indica will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2005 Saab 05-Sep will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
